				Trying To Connect 2 Pc's
			 
 
			
			We have two pc's that we want to share our 2meg ntl cable broadband connection. We have one cable modem, 1 ethernet wire, and 1 crossover cable. The main pc has 2 ethernet slots, the second pc has one ethernet slot. I have connected it all up but the net is only availabel on the 1st pc. Am i missing something? Do ntl allow you to do this? I've heard its possible to browse the net on both and have them connected like a lan without having to buy a hub or a router.

I've heard its possible to browse the net on both and have them connected like a lan without having to buy a hub or a router. |  You need to enable internet connection sharing on the PC attached to the cable modem see here for details http://practicallynetworked.com/sharing/xp_ics/
